The allocation of barriers for Drivers competing in the 2015 World Driving Championship (WDC) has been determined in a random draw of positions undertaken at the offices of Harness Racing New South Wales (HRNSW).
A feature of the 2015 Championship, which starts on Saturday night, 21 February at Tabcorp Park Menangle, is the decision to allow each of the Drivers to start twice from each of the ten (10) barrier positions across the twenty (20) Heat series. Nominated horses will then be drawn randomly to barrier positions when fields are released.
Host country representative Chris Alford (Australia) will get the chance to open his account from the prized barrier one (1) position, while Defending Champion, Pierre Vercruysse (France) will leave the gate from barrier five (5) in the first Heat.
All Heats are mobile start races and all bar one Heat are pacing races.
Points for the Championship are awarded in each race according to the final, official order of finish, on the following basis:
Number of Starters – 10:
17 (1st place); 12 (2nd place); 9 (3rd place); 7 (4th); 6 (5th); 5 (6th); 4 (7th); 3 (8th); 2 (9th) & 1 (10th)
Number of Starters – 9:
16 (1st); 11 (2nd); 8 (3rd); 6 (4th); 5 (5th); 4 (6th); 3 (7th); 2 (8th) & 1 (9th)
Number of Starters – 8:
15 (1st); 10 (2nd); 7 (3rd); 5 (4th); 4 (5th); 3 (6th); 2 (7th) & 1 (8th)
Drivers will start arriving in Australia from Thursday this week and are congregating at Tabcorp Park Menangle on Friday afternoon, 20 February, for a familiarisation and integrity information session before joining the Mayor and Councillors of the City of Campbelltown for a Civic Reception and official welcome.
